You do the go to window mode, move the window around, then full screen HDR fix right. Because HDR is bugged at the moment and you have to do the above to get HDR working. If you open up options / developer mode, turn it on and turn on the little window that shows fps and main thread, you’ll see at the top it will say either SDR or HDR. If its says SDR then that would explain the lighting issue. I dont know about the GPU/CPU usage since I never checked performance monitor when it was happening. But it could be?

Just because you see 600mbps on a speed test doesnt mean your getting 600mpbs to the server. If you want to check that get a copy of pingplotter and install it. Then open the sim, start a flight, and either sit on the ground or fly on autopilot, then go into task manager/performance and click on the bottom left of the screen the Resource Monitor. Find flightsm in the list of programs, click on that so your only seeing the machines that the sim is connected to. Now write down the address in the box under ethernet (should be 5) then quit everything sim task mon resource man etc, open pingplotter, then put those address in 1 by one and watch it run, if you you see connections that have high latency or packet loss then that could be your problem as well ( dont worry about machines that dont respond at all, those are usually busy routers that are programed not to respond to you requests for security reasons).

No if you see High Latency on any of the connections, and the problems machine(S) are on your providers network, call and complain, it will take awhile because most level 1 tech’s are useless, but eventually if you persiver you might get it taken care of by them. If its off the ISP’s network theres nothing you can do about that.
